Sarfaraz Ahmed: "It's very unfortunate - we played good cricket but haven't qualified. That one game, against West Indies, cost us the tournament. Boys responded well after the India game. Did well in all three after that - batting, bowling, fielding. When we started the World Cup, we had a different combination. We need to sit down. We have two months off, and we need to do a lot of work with the team. At the moment, when team is winning everything is fine. Credit to our batsmen - Imam, Babar and Haris. And the bowlers - Amir, Shadab, Wahab, Shaheen. The way Shaheen is bowling, the consistency is amazing. One of the best bowling performances I've ever seen."

Mashrafe Mortaza: "I think both matches - last two matches - Shakib batted so well but we couldn't get partnerships. Game was 50-50, think we could've chased it, but partnerships were missing. I want to say sorry for Shakib, if we stepped up the tournament could've been different. Batted, bowled, fielded well - he was fantastic. Some important matches, our fielding wasn't good. It cost us a lot. Batting was fantastic. Mustafizur, starting from his career, he was unplayable. He got injured, but since our Ireland tour he's been really good. Hopefully no injuries for him in the future. Real asset for Bangladesh cricket. We are not satisfied. Could've finished the World Cup on a good note, but end of the day, we've had a 50-50 World Cup. You give your 100%, and sometimes you need a bit of luck - but it's never been with us. I will go home and rethink of my career, and then make a final call. Thanks to all supporters - present all over the ground and back home. They keep supporting us. Hopefully next time we will make them happy."

6.06 pm Shaheen's celebratory march off is pre-empted as the Pakistan squad create a mini-guard of honor for Shoaib Malik. He's not in the XI today but they wanted to give him whatever dignified farewell may be possible at his last World Cup for the 37-year-old ex-captain.
